Grounded AI

Grounded AI is artificial intelligence that produces outputs anchored in verified, retrievable sources rather than generating text from statistical patterns alone, so every answer rests on real evidence that can be located and confirmed.

Grounding constrains the model. Instead of composing a fluent guess, the system retrieves relevant, trusted material and builds its answer on top of it. The result stays tethered to fact.

This is the direct antidote to invention. An ungrounded model can produce a confident, wrong answer with no way to tell. A grounded one shows its sources, so accuracy can be checked.

For enterprises, grounding is what separates a demo from a system you can put in front of a client.
